In this role, you will use your experience and education to perform water and wastewater system hydraulic modeling and analyses, evaluate potential improvements to optimize system performance, and support the development of master plans.

Responsibilities

  • Understand how surface water infrastructure, stormwater systems, water distribution systems, and/or wastewater collection systems operate and the facilities in each system.
  • Develop surface water, drinking water, or wastewater models using commercially available software such as HEC-HMS, HEC-RAS, or PCSWMM for surface water systems; InfoWater Pro, WaterGEMS, AquaTwin Water for water distribution systems; or PCSWMM, InfoWorks ICM, AquaTwin Sewer, or SewerGEMS for wastewater systems.
  • Perform flow monitoring and/or field testing to collect data for model calibration.
  • Calibrate models using measured or observed data.
  • Use models to analyze system performance, identify deficiencies, and/or evaluate risk.
  • Develop system improvements to address existing and future deficiencies.
  • Provide reports detailing model development, calibration, analysis, and recommended improvements.
  • Perform modeling to size or verify the size of new facilities for a design project.
